I keep getting these bruise like patches on the palms of my hands that are really painful and itch...what could it be? You can t always see the purple reddish spots but the pain is always there and really severe and it happens to the bottom of my feet to.
Hi. As per your case history you are having idiopathic palmoplantar hidradenitis, my treatment advice is - 1. Avoid spicy foods and extra salt in your diet. 2. Also avoid stress as it may worsen the condition. 3. Take a NSAID like ibuprofen twice daily for 7-10 days. 4. Apply a mild topical steroid cream like mometasone cream twice daily on affected skin. 5. Other treatment options are oral antibiotics, oral colchicine and oral steroids taken only after consulting a dermatologist.
